ABOUT

Skyway Tutoring and Rites of Passage was visioned by Rev. Dr. Steve Baber, to enhance and support academic and educational pursuits for primarily underserved youth of the greater Skyway community. Initially community volunteers visited local elementary schools to read and support teachers in their classroom instructions.
Our programs are non-discriminatory and non-sectarian providing direct services to children and youth ages 5-18, including providing assistance to their families where possible. We have collaborative relationships both public and private schools based on where our students attend.

This program functions solely with volunteer staff and tutors. Therefore donations received go directly into and towards program materials and resources.  
We currently provide onsite and virtual tutoring.

Sample Tutoring Session
Session
Minutes
(60 minutes)
Get acquainted and catch up
10
Skill Building (flash cards, reading aloud, site words) ​
10​
Review Homework
30
Free Time (games, art)
5
Wrap-up (snacks clean up)
5
